As a Teacher Aide, you'll play a vital role in supporting children in our Special Education Program by encouraging growth in social, emotional, physical, and cognitive areas.
Primary Responsibilities and Essential Functions of Position:
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
- Ability to work collaboratively in a team-oriented environment.
- Patience, empathy, and a passion for supporting diverse learners.
- Walk to and from various locations in the building.
- May need to stoop, bend, and sometimes lift or push wheelchairs of children being served.
- Physical intervention techniques may be required to aid the children in challenging moments.
- Specific vision abilities include close vision, distance vision and ability to focus.
- Provide one-on-one support to students during activities and lessons to help them engage with the curriculum.
- Foster a Positive Learning Environment
- Create an inclusive and nurturing classroom atmosphere that promotes social, emotional, and cognitive development.
- Encourage positive interactions among students and support their social skills development.
- Help students with daily routines, including arrival, meals, bathroom use, and transitions between activities.
- Support students in participating in group activities, encouraging communication and cooperation.
- Behavioral Support
- Monitor student behavior and implement positive behavior management strategies.
- Work with teachers to address challenging behaviors and provide consistent support.
- Communicate regularly with teachers and specialists to discuss student progress and challenges.
- Assist in communicating with families about their child's needs and achievements.
- Ensure that classroom materials and equipment are safe and accessible for all students.
- Supervise students during free play and outdoor activities to ensure safety.
- Adhere to all health and safety policies and procedures while supervising the children at all times
- Assist in preparing instructional materials and resources for classroom activities.
- Participate in emergency interventions outlined by SCIP-R trainings and BIPs.
- This position follows a 12-month school calendar, with hours from 8:00 a.m. to 3:30 p.m.
